Understanding AKD Surface Sizing Agents
What is AKD?
Alkyl Ketene Dimer (AKD) is a versatile sizing agent that allows paper manufacturers to create products with enhanced water resistance and strength. Its unique molecular structure facilitates strong bonds with cellulose fibers, improving the overall quality of the paper.
How AKD Works
AKD acts as a sizing agent by forming an ester bond with the hydroxyl groups in cellulose. This bond effectively creates a barrier that prevents liquid penetration, making the paper more durable and suitable for various applications, including printing and packaging.
Advantages of Using AKD
-
Enhanced Water Resistance: AKD significantly improves the paper’s resistance to water and oils, making it ideal for packaging and printing applications.
-
Cost-Effectiveness: Compared to alternative sizing agents, AKD requires lower dosages, resulting in reduced costs for manufacturers without compromising quality.
-
Improved Production Efficiency: AKD’s unique properties lead to smoother production processes, reducing machine downtime and enhancing operational efficiency.
-
Better Printability: The improved surface characteristics of AKD-treated paper contribute to better ink adhesion, resulting in high-quality prints.
Applications of AKD Surface Sizing Agents
1. Printing Papers
AKD is widely used in the production of high-quality printing papers. Its ability to improve surface properties ensures that inks adhere better, resulting in sharper and more vibrant prints.
2. Packaging Papers
The water and oil resistance imparted by AKD make it a favored choice for packaging materials, ensuring that products remain protected from moisture and contamination.
3. Specialty Papers
In specialty paper manufacturing, AKD enhances the durability and functionality of papers used in products like labels, envelopes, and food packaging.
4. Cultural Papers
For cultural papers, AKD provides the necessary strength and printability, ensuring that they meet the diverse needs of the market.
